What is the 5th House in astrology?

In astrology, the “Houses” refer to 12 different sectors of an astrological chart, each representing a different area of your life. Imagine a wheel divided into 12 slices—those are the Houses. The 5th House is often referred to as the “House of Pleasure”. This House is associated with joy, creativity, romance, self-expression, and the things that bring us delight and happiness. It’s the area of your life that you naturally gravitate towards when you want to have fun or express yourself without any inhibitions. It also governs hobbies, sports, games, and leisure activities. Simply put, the 5th House is where your playful and creative side comes to life.

5th house astrology

The 5th House is also linked to children and your approach to parenting. It represents how you express love and generosity towards others, especially those younger than you. Moreover, it’s connected to risk-taking and speculation, which includes everything from financial investments to taking a chance on love. The sign and any planets in this House can give you insight into these areas of your life, indicating how you seek enjoyment and express your unique individuality.

Aries in the 5th House meaning

Let’s delve into what it means if you have Aries in your 5th House.

1. You are incredibly passionate

With Aries in your 5th House, you’re likely to be incredibly passionate. This is especially true when it comes to love, creativity, and self-expression, the areas of life governed by the 5th House. Aries, being a cardinal fire sign ruled by Mars, is characterized by its energy, enthusiasm, and courage. This sign doesn’t do things by halves. When Aries commit to something, they pour their entire self into it. When this fiery, assertive energy is channeled into the 5th House, it results in a passionate expression of creativity, love, and play. You’re likely to approach these areas with unbridled zeal, expressing yourself boldly and passionately. Whether it’s pursuing a romantic interest, embarking on a creative project, or engaging in leisure activities, you give it your all, and your passion is evident for all to see.

2. You are a natural flirt

If Aries rules your 5th House, you’re likely to be a natural flirt. The 5th House is traditionally associated with romance, pleasure, and self-expression. Meanwhile, Aries, as a cardinal fire sign ruled by Mars, is known for its assertiveness, confidence, and charisma. When these two energies combine, they create an individual who is not only bold and confident but also naturally adept at the art of flirtation. Your Aries influence means you’re not afraid to take the initiative in romantic situations. This means you often make the first move with enthusiasm and charm. You enjoy the thrill of the chase and the playful dance of attraction. Plus, you’re always using your wit, warmth, and vivacity to captivate those around you. However, it’s important to remember that while your flirtatious nature can be exhilarating, it’s essential to ensure your attention is welcomed and reciprocated.

Aries in 5th house astrology

3. You fall in and out of love quickly

Having Aries in your 5th House can mean that you have a tendency to fall in and out of love quickly. This is because the 5th House is associated with romance, creativity, and self-expression. With fiery Aries energy in this house, you may find yourself drawn to passionate and intense relationships that are fueled by excitement and adventure. However, your impulsive nature and need for constant stimulation can also lead to a pattern of quickly falling in love with someone new. It also means you may lose interest just as fast. This can be due to your desire for independence and the need to constantly pursue new experiences. It’s important for you to find a balance between spontaneity and stability in your relationships. It’s also vital to learn to stay committed even when the initial excitement wears off when you meet the right person.

4. You know what you want in life

With Aries in your 5th House, you likely have a clear vision of what you want in life. The 5th House represents creativity, self-expression, and personal desires. Meanwhile, Aries is a sign characterized by its determination, initiative, and leadership qualities. This combination suggests that you’re not one to be swayed by others’ opinions or expectations. Instead, you have the courage to follow your heart, pursue your passions, and express your true self. Your Aries influence gives you the assertiveness to go after what you desire. Whether it’s a romantic interest, a creative venture, or a life goal, Aries know what they want! You’re not afraid to take risks, make bold decisions, or stand out from the crowd if it means achieving what you truly want. This clear sense of purpose, combined with your fiery passion and drive, often makes you a force to be reckoned with.

5. You may act impulsively

If Aries presides over your 5th House, it’s likely that you sometimes act impulsively. The 5th House, combined with the fiery energy of Aries, can lead to spontaneous and impetuous actions. Aries, being a cardinal fire sign ruled by Mars, is known for its pioneering spirit, courage, and a certain level of impatience. This means when an idea or desire strikes, you don’t just sit on it; you act. Whether it’s confessing feelings to a love interest, starting a new creative project, or jumping headfirst into a recreational activity, you’re inclined to follow your instincts without much deliberation. While this spontaneity can bring excitement and novelty, it’s important to remember that every action has consequences.
